Transaction 50869cc9d221ce191e6310d775b643ea5c26c4a43c6839307b19e9591eb7e5cc
4 Input
2 Outputs
- 50869cc9d221ce191e6310d775b643ea5c26c4a43c6839307b19e9591eb7e5cc:0
- 50869cc9d221ce191e6310d775b643ea5c26c4a43c6839307b19e9591eb7e5cc:1
value 84800734
address 125FzXMAC2gkpBJeYjRHdrtTTKbNjxge63
value 1710208804
address 3PZmHfHM2RLJUJFj3A6eu5yaJLZSJUaYif